Depends what your needs are. I have the 360 which allows the baby to face front ways, but to be honest I have only used this feature once or twice and it's not really recommended for a child to be front facing for too long or too often.
If you are in a warm climate maybe go with the mesh or airflow model. Organic is also probably cooler.

Possibly the waistband - in the 360 it's a thick velcro band which has pro's (more supportive) and cons (makes a noise when you take it off) but the newer models might all have this.
